基于tpWallet最新版兑币截图的深度安全与技术分析

本文基于对一张tpWallet最新版兑币(Swap)界面截图的深度解析,围绕私密数据管理、合约调用机制、专业研究方法、未来支付技术、智能化资产管理与防欺诈技术六大维度展开,旨在为普通用户、研究者与产品方提供可操作建议。

一、截图可见信息与隐私风险

截图通常包含:交易对、代币图标、数量、滑点设置、接收地址、交易费估算、批准(Approve)提示和签名按钮。风险点:

- 暴露地址/昵称或交易历史片段会关联链上身份;

- 若截图含有部分交易哈希或签名请求文本(EIP-712友好消息),可能泄露敏感授权信息;

- EXIF/元数据(若未清理)会暴露设备或地理信息。建议:截图前清除元数据、遮挡地址与敏感字段;应用提供内置“隐私截图”功能。

二、合约调用与安全要点

兑币通常触发两类合约交互:ERC-20的approve/transferFrom与路由合约的swap调用(如swapExactTokensForTokens)。需关注:

- Approve额度:若为无限批准(max uint256),被攻击合约可持续转移资产;优先使用最小必要额度或使用EIP-2612 permit签名减少approve流程;

- 路由参数:滑点容忍度、deadline、path、接收地址,错误参数会导致滑点损失或资产被送至攻击地址;

- 合约地址与字节码:确保调用目标为已验证合约并查阅其源代码与审计报告;

- 重放与前置交易(front-running/MEV):高滑点或大额交易易受夹击,建议使用私有交易池(flashbots)或分步小额执行。

三、专业研究与验证流程

面向研究者与安全人员的实务步骤:

1) 从截图提取线索(合约地址、代币合约、交易参数);

2) 在区块浏览器验证合约是否已验证并审计;

3) 使用静态分析工具(Slither、MythX)与符号执行检查常见漏洞;

4) 在Fork链或沙箱环境回放交易(Tenderly、Ganache)以观察实际代币流向与事件日志;

5) 分析approve/transferFrom的调用链,识别中间代理合约或授权跳板;

6) 若怀疑鱼叉式诈骗,追踪资金流向并导出链上地址关联图谱。

四、面向未来的支付技术趋势

兑币界面与支付场景正向以下方向发展:

- L2与聚合支付:更多用户通过zk-rollups/Optimistic链进行低费率结算与跨链桥接;

- 原生可编程支付:基于智能合约的定期支付、条件支付与可撤销支付(支付流、流动资金池);

- 隐私增强支付:集成zk技术和最小信息披露协议以减少交易元数据泄露;

- 可组合金融(Composability):钱包成为支付合约与资产管理策略的编排器。

五、智能化资产管理策略

钱包与服务可引入智能功能:

- 自动仓位管理:基于阈值触发止盈止损或自动再平衡;

- Gas 与滑点优化:按链上拥堵与历史MEV模型选择最佳打包策略或分批交易;

- Oracles 与策略回测:用预言机数据驱动策略并在沙箱回测风险;

- 多签/社保恢复与MPC:把私钥风险降到最低,同时支持社交恢复与阈值签名。

六、防欺诈与防护技术

针对截图中可能揭示的攻击面,关键防护包含:

- UX层面警告:在approve无限授权、非经常接收地址或大额交易时弹出强化提示并要求二次确认;

- 签名人类可读化(EIP-712友好文本)与合约信誉分级;

- 行为风控:本地或云端检测异常交易模式、时间窗内多次高额批准或短时内大量撤销并阻断风险交易;

- 追溯与冻结协作:与链上分析机构建立黑名单与可疑地址共享机制;

- 硬件与TEE:优先建议硬件钱包或受信执行环境签名以防密钥窃取。

结语:一张tpWallet的兑币截图虽然只是界面瞬间,但可揭示多个安全与设计问题:私密数据泄露风险、合约调用误用、以及用户体验对安全决策的影响。对用户而言,应养成“小额测试、复核合约地址、定期撤销授权”的习惯;对产品方,应把合约可读性、权限最小化与反欺诈机制内置到钱包体验中。研究者与审计者则需结合链上溯源、静态/动态分析与模拟回放,形成闭环的检测与告警流程。

作者:林沐澈发布时间:2025-09-13 09:30:44

评论

SkyWalker

这篇分析很实用,尤其是关于无限授权和EIP-2612的建议,能直观降低风险。

雨茜

建议软件增加隐私截图功能和EXIF自动清理,避免无意中泄露设备信息。

Neo_Coder

补充一点:可以在钱包内置合约信誉评分,结合链上行为与审计报告给出风险评级。

链上小陈

同意分批小额执行和使用私有池的建议,实测能显著降低被夹击的几率。

相关阅读